Basic information Safety Related Supplier
21H,23H-Porphine, 5,15-bis(4-bromophenyl)- Structure

21H,23H-Porphine, 5,15-bis(4-bromophenyl)-

21H,23H-Porphine, 5,15-bis(4-bromophenyl)- Supplier